teapot
- Museum number
- 1943,0201.1
- Description
-
Teapot with twisted double handle, finial on the lid. Earthenware covered inside and out with a white tin glaze. Painted mostly in manganese purple: one side a landscape with ruins and birds; on the other two `chinoiserie style' figures with trees, rocks and birds. Edge of spout painted blue. On the lid another figure with trees and birds; edged in blue.
